Yes, the University of New England provides off-campus accommodation. Students can choose private rentals, shared housing, or boarding options near the campus, with support available to help them find suitable places.

The university accepts admission applications on a trimester basis. Admissions to most courses are open for the first & second trimesters only.
The upcoming deadline for first trimester (Feb-Jun) is End of November of the previous year while that of second trimester (Jun-Oct) is End of May.
